Snapchat takes swipe at competitors’ under-emphasis on sound, calling muted video advertising ‘moving banners’

Snapchat believes sound is quintessential to advertising, arguing this is the platform’s advantage over those competitors whose users are less inclined to engage with audio in video advertising, or less encouraged to do so.
